#312e7c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#312e7c is composed of 19.2% red, 18%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.5% cyan, 62.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 242.3 degrees, a saturation of 45.9% and a lightness of 33.3%. #312e7c color hex could be obtained by blending #625cf8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#312e7c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04040a is the darkest color, while #fafafd is the lightest one.
